Paid Internship
Work Mode
Time Spent
Required Degree
Duration

Open Positions

Experience More On the Go

GET IT ONGoogle Play
Download on theApp Store
© 2026you'll get it. all rights reserved.

Internship Explorer

  • Explore
  • Saved Internships
Sign In

Internship Explorer

  • Explore
  • Saved Internships
Sign In
Paid Internship
Work Mode
Time Spent
Required Degree
Duration

19Open Positions

Auto-load
  • Software Engineer Intern - 12 month Industry Placement

    Roku
    Cambridge, United Kingdom
    Found 3 weeks ago
  • Research Engineer, Software Engineer for Combustion Libraries (RE1)

    Barcelona Supercomputing Center
    Barcelona, Spain
    Found 2 weeks ago
  • Apprentice Aircraft Engine Technician

    globalhr
    Leighton Buzzard, United Kingdom
    Found 2 weeks ago
  • Internship

    MTU Maintenance
    Munich, Germany
    Found 4 weeks ago
  • Working Student in Propulsion Valve Development (m/f/d)

    Isar Aerospace
    Ottobrunn, Germany
    Found 1 month ago
  • PhD Candidate - Shock-detonation dynamics of energetic materials for advanced aerospace propulsion

    IMDEA Materials Institute
    Madrid, Spain
    Found 2 months ago
  • Propulsion Engineer (F/M/X)

    ISPTech
    Ludwigsburg, Germany
    Found 2 months ago
  • Propulsion Test Engineer Intern (F/M/X)

    ISPTech
    Ludwigsburg, Germany
    Found 2 months ago
  • Werkstudent (m/w/x) im Bereich Qualitätssicherung Triebwerke Aerospace

    ottofuchskg
    Meinerzhagen, Germany
    Found 2 months ago
  • 6 months internship - Propulsion Test Engineer (m/f/d)

    Isar Aerospace
    Kiruna, Sweden
    Found 2 months ago
  • Schülerpraktikum (all genders)

    MTU Aero Engines AG
    Langenhagen, Germany
    Found 3 months ago
  • Schülerpraktikum

    MTU Aero Engines AG
    Langenhagen, Germany
    Found 3 months ago
  • Schülerpraktikum (all genders)

    MTU Aero Engines AG
    Langenhagen, Germany
    Found 3 months ago

Software Engineer Intern - 12 month Industry Placement

Roku
Found 3 weeks ago
Location
Cambridge, United Kingdom
Time
Full-time
Work Mode
Hybrid
Salary
paid
Visa Help
Not disclosed
Last Verified
3 weeks ago

Education

  • Bachelor

Skills & Qualifications

Technical Skills

  • C/C++
  • Linux
  • Python
  • Bash/Shell

Soft Skills

  • debugging and problem-solving
  • collaboratively
  • communicating clearly
  • self-driven mindset
  • willingness to learn quickly
  • teamwork

Job Description

This internship is a great fit for a student going into their Placement Year who’s interested in embedded software development and software quality. You’ll help improve product quality and developer efficiency by contributing to automatable tests, debugging issues, and improving testing workflows for C/C++ applications running on embedded/Linux-based systems. We offer a paid 12 month internship, starting in September 2026. What you'll be doing With guidance from the team, you will: * Develop and maintain automated tests for applications written in C/C++ * Write scripts/tools (Python and/or Bash) to support test automation and analysis * Learn how to use logs, KPIs, and failure analysis to help reproduce, isolate, and understand issues * Review and improve existing test cases and automation code with support from mentors * Document test procedures, results, and learnings clearly and concisely * Collaborate with remote team members across time zones and communicate progress effectively

Requirements

  • Current enrolment in a Bachelor’s (or equivalent) in Computer Engineering, Computer Science, or a related field
  • Available for a 12 month period starting in September 2026
  • Some experience programming in C and/or C++ (coursework, projects, labs, or internships)
  • Familiarity with Linux fundamentals and basic command-line tools
  • Basic scripting skills in Python and/or Bash/Shell
  • Interest in debugging and problem-solving (e.g., reading logs, reproducing issues, step-by-step investigation)
  • Comfort working collaboratively and communicating clearly in a distributed environment
  • A self-driven mindset and willingness to learn quickly in a fast-paced team

Related Field

  • Software Engineering

Related Subfield

  • Software QA & Testing

Languages

  • English

Nice to Haves

  • Exposure to embedded Linux development (e.g., Raspberry Pi, development boards, or coursework)
  • Familiarity with multi-threading concepts and/or memory management fundamentals
  • Experience writing tests (unit tests, integration tests, or white-box tests)
  • Any experience working with software running on SoCs or constrained devices
▶Apply Now

Similar Roles You Might Like

  • Software Engineer Intern, Embedded

    Roku
    Cambridge, United Kingdom
    Found 3 weeks ago
  • Embedded System Test Engineer - Internship

    Cirrus Logic
    Edinburgh, United Kingdom
    Found 1 month ago
  • Embedded Software Engineer (Connectivity / Telematics) - Internship

    redbend
    Bucharest, Romania
    Found 3 weeks ago
  • Summer Internship Validation (m/f/d)

    NXP Semiconductors
    Gratkorn, Austria
    Found 1 month ago
  • Summer Internship: Lab Validation (m/f/d)

    NXP Semiconductors
    Gratkorn, Austria
    Found 1 month ago
  • Software Engineering Internship H/F

    Alice & Bob
    Paris, France
    Found 2 days ago